柠檬酸铋 (III) 被用作离心柱的吸附剂,开发了一种新型固定相,通过固相萃取 (SPE) 法从天然来源中选择性有效分离酚类化合物。它可用于合成碱式碳酸铋 ((BiO)2CO3) 纳米管,据报道属性这些纳米管显示出抗幽门螺杆菌的抗菌性能。 Bismuth(III) citrate has been used as a sorbent in spin columns to develop a novel stationary phase for the selective and efficient isolation of phenolic compounds from natural sources via solid phase extraction (SPE) method. It can be used to synthesize bismuth subcarbonate ((BiO)2CO3) nanotubes that are reported to show antibacterial property againstHelicobacter pylori.
